A US official told the Wall Street Journal that US forces fired pre-dawn Tuesday on a Panama‑flagged vessel attempting to run a US blockade of an Iranian port. The official said a US helicopter fired at the ship’s steering compartment after the crew ignored warnings from US personnel enforcing the blockade. There were no reports of casualties. The official said the vessel appeared to try to transfer crew to another civilian ship after being struck. Earlier Tuesday maritime security firm Vanguard reported that the Panama‑flagged container ship Vela Nova, westbound in the Gulf of Oman, was hit by a helicopter‑launched missile about 71 nautical miles off Pakistan; the missile ignited a fire that was later extinguished and all 17 crew were accounted for.
